diff --git a/src/gpu/VirtualFluids_GPU/Calculation/UpdateGrid27.cpp b/src/gpu/VirtualFluids_GPU/Calculation/UpdateGrid27.cpp
index d496add47ff0c8e8d1b993172d2e568ae4b36d10..e43389a62d417c76a96777aa2bcb534cae313358 100644
--- a/src/gpu/VirtualFluids_GPU/Calculation/UpdateGrid27.cpp
+++ b/src/gpu/VirtualFluids_GPU/Calculation/UpdateGrid27.cpp
@@ -1470,7 +1470,7 @@ void UpdateGrid27::chooseFunctionForCollisionAndExchange(Parameter *para)
         std::cout << "Cuda Streams can only be used with kernels which run using fluidNodesIndices." << std::endl;
 
     } else if (para->getUseStreams() && para->getNumprocs() <= 1) {
-        std::cout << "Cuda Streams can only be with multiple MPI processes." << std::endl;
+        std::cout << "Cuda Streams can only be used with multiple MPI processes." << std::endl;
     
     } else if (!para->getUseStreams() && para->getKernelNeedsFluidNodeIndicesToRun()) {
         this->collisionAndExchange = [](Parameter *para, std::vector<std::shared_ptr<PorousMedia>> &pm, int level,